Cyanotype Workshop
This workshop teaches the cyanotype process with a digital twist. Cyanotype printing is an alternative process that dates from 1842 and does not require a darkroom, just sun, a negative, and some water. Participants will learn the basics of contact printing and go home with a cyanotype and toned cyanotype print of their photograph. The workshop will demonstrate the cyanotype process from coating the paper to toning the final print. Participants will experiment with photograms, make prints from their own negative, and learn how to produce a digital negative.
